On Mon, Feb 15, 2016 at 08:57:26PM +0000, Mark Brown wrote:
> On Fri, Feb 12, 2016 at 07:46:10AM +0530, Subhransu S. Prusty wrote:
> > It's possible for hw_params to be called two times. So add NULL
> > check to prevent memory leak.
>
> Another fix?
Yes but can go in 4.6 as HDMI codec does not get created in 4.5 code. That
is why I didn't send this one in last fixes series
>
> > - dd = kzalloc(sizeof(*dd), GFP_KERNEL);
> > - if (!dd)
> > - return -ENOMEM;
> > + dd = (struct hdac_ext_dma_params *)
> > + snd_soc_dai_get_dma_data(dai, substream);
>
> If you need to cast away from void * that suggests a problem and it'd
> look a lot neater too.
I suspect there is no need for cast, we seem to ahve a habit for that, let
us check that
